Package: mldonkey-server Version: 3.1.6-1+b1 Severity: normal Tags: patch -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512
Dear Maintainer, As part of adding mldonkey into FreedomBox, we noticed that the mldonkey-server does not stop properly. This is because start-stop-daemon is asked to stop based only on the PID file which is owned by non-root user. Making the process match more specific fixes the problem. # start-stop-daemon --stop --pidfile /var/run/mldonkey/mlnet.pid start-stop-daemon: matching only on non-root pidfile /var/run/mldonkey/mlnet.pid is insecure # echo $? 2 # start-stop-daemon --stop --pidfile /var/run/mldonkey/mlnet.pid --exec /usr/bin/mlnet # echo $? 0 I have created a merge request to fix the issue. Tagging this issue with 'patch'. https://salsa.debian.org/ocaml-team/mldonkey/merge_requests/1 - -- System Information: Debian Release: buster/sid APT prefers testing APT policy: (500, 'testing') Architecture: amd64 (x86_64) Kernel: Linux 4.19.0-1-amd64 (SMP w/4 CPU cores) Locale: LANG=en_IN.UTF-8, LC_CTYPE=en_IN.UTF-8 (charmap=UTF-8), LANGUAGE=en_IN.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system) LSM: AppArmor: enabled Versions of packages mldonkey-server depends on: ii adduser 3.118 ii debconf [debconf-2.0] 1.5.70 ii libbz2-1.0 1.0.6-9 ii libc6 2.28-5 ii libgcc1 1:8.2.0-14 ii libgd3 2.2.5-5 ii libjpeg62-turbo 1:1.5.2-2+b1 ii libpng16-16 1.6.36-2 ii libstdc++6 8.2.0-14 ii lsb-base 10.2018112800 ii mime-support 3.61 ii ucf 3.0038+nmu1 ii zlib1g 1:1.2.11.dfsg-1 mldonkey-server recommends no packages. -----BEGIN PGP SIGNATURE----- iQJFBAEBCgAvFiEE5xPDY9ZyWnWupXSBQ+oc/wqnxfIFAlxLhiMRHHN1bmlsQG1l ZGhhcy5vcmcACgkQQ+oc/wqnxfK/1w/9H/vFfCW/N7EM1DkzWkHoNzKtaW/Xn0Ih rJzb7fUyq3LFBexILTMHvgz8d/hPoRFuktgY2Thvq8E546bRB4oYfStXfFO+njXd LkMKEPhyKqTgOfRjCMKVr7QUtBpYN5XBze99esEhIGzg9Al/vZXyBxtz4voFJ2LL R0p/0FlWCT6fXsy3z0T5Mfm0jV4IyC42bh/1MemzR7ATmvc6mL9/TMXV3vZEdX2A OMu+XRkJhown5vQVeC32hfJWreb5J93urVPdHXltXZb5tJjvx9X3tfNAK3i/EEx+ 5aXktK4/TP8BAj/A2uJ6yxf4vE5HFPxrca8ZrX4qcjstHuaB/yGCru2oWaUzkBD5 0RFn5HOtwXI8NXVP6zTIimVQqkoXzeY8SQsSQBToWkxjJchXQ0u9EiijdZM5nDNJ qfJVp/qk6okK9MerP2sNwtHAWyxgOa5iqFrifITmLoJfZrmtkkg4VRs1eYpCGHr9 v9E2wCsKfRp2V/tKzASbxk6Oc7P7iEBWMmQTAmuSmK84k2VvQTwjMy+OCOOeIue5 Gqdwz1+BgpIF4baRgIalYIu9iGHfQBErfY3GLgcdjJx+ketfqZHw3VTlLjCipfUt D/ppP5q4FlHnlb5OraNakVwei1Bdn2wK7UnevjqGcMMYRm5m1YkK3Ci3gUnwz4zv Ruln29zlUD8= =5KnO -----END PGP SIGNATURE-----